06BCBANSHEE Posted March 3, 2013 Report Posted March 3, 2013 Well I recently installed a bunch of parts in the last two weeks. pretty much went over everything, cleaned carbs installed new rad,stabilizer,stem, fat bars, vforce4 reeds, manually sync carbs had 280 mains, 30 pilot before the reeds. was kinda boggy so i dropped it to a 27.5 ran great. Dunno if I am being a hyprochondriatic or what, but I re installed everything , put the tank on. Dunno if it did this before or not, but my fuel line from the petcock to the carbs keeps getting air bubbles. it feels like its struggling for fuel at 0- 1/8 throttle, Doesnt seem like the air bubbles are normal, took it for a ride and it kinda struggles at very little throttle, after that it flat out rips. kinda shitty pic sorry for such the dumb questions Quote

trickedcarbine Posted March 3, 2013 Report Posted March 3, 2013 Try and make sure the fuel hoses have a smooth down ward flow with no harsh bends. Make sure the vent and over flow lines arent goobered up with that greasy shit build up. Also, don't know your mods, but a gutted gas cap might help. With the VForce 4's you should be up an additional size. Try the 30 again. Quote
